>   I use the 4.3-Stable, and i want then my
>   sound-on-mather-board "VIA VT82C686A" be worked.

>   in my kernel config file:
>     device pcm0 at isa? irq 10 drq 1 flags 0x0 - not worked?

>   How may, i do this?
>   cvsup to -current???

the on-board soundcard is a pci device, not an isa device, so all you
need in your kernel config is "device pcm" without any of the isa, irq
and other stuff.
